Itinerary

This 2-day tour kicks off with an early morning pickup from your hotel or the Cusco airport.
You’ll venture into the Sacred Valley, stopping at Pisac’s vibrant market and exploring the Inca ruins.
After lunch, you’ll visit the impressive Ollantaytambo fortress before boarding a train to Aguas Calientes.
The next day, you’ll rise early and embark on a guided tour of the iconic Machu Picchu.
Rise early for a guided tour of the iconic Machu Picchu and learn about its impressive engineering and spiritual significance.
With ample time to explore this wonder, you’ll learn about the Inca’s impressive engineering and the site’s spiritual significance.
After, you’ll return to Cusco, concluding this immersive Andean experience.
